This week's issue of Famitsu includes a feature on the Cindered Shadows DLC for Fire Emblem: Three Houses, as well as the game in general. It includes some commentary from the dev team as well. Check out a summary of the info below.

Cindered Shadows DLC

- the DLC is fairly difficult, and the dev team thinks it'll take players 8-10 hours to complete on normal
- unlock more stuff in the main game as you make your way through the DLC

Free updates

- free update will let you have tea time with Rhea
- Byleth will be able to wear dancer clothes, but not become a dancer
- change costumes from the free day menu, as well as change everyone's costumes at once

Developer tidbits

- golden route is not planned
- the devs were against the idea since it would become the "right path" in fan's minds
- 'Maddening' difficulty was really hard for the team to balance, so they were happy with the release timing of it
- the team expects Intelligent Systems to put out a full OST at some point
